Increase the Peace in Your Life: Avoid Drama

God intends to develop good in our relationships with friends, loved ones, spouses, ex-spouses, bosses, and family members. No matter what issues you have in any relationship in your life right now, God can make them function properly and even become enjoyable once again.

i believe alot of situations in our lives can be symptomatic of larger problems. a central issue in many of our lives is the inability to live life without large amounts of DRAMA involved. for some of us, if there is no drama and nothing wrong in our lives at any given time, we dont know how to act.

think of all the problems that are in your life right now and honestly analyze how much of it was self-inflicted, a result of what i call "drama-seeking".

you might say that there were real problems associated with the people involved in your life's issues, but the truth is that everyone has issues with the people there in relationship with.

could it be that we blow these standard relational issues out of proportion?

does it ever seem that sometimes your almost addicted to DRAMA? maybe you've went on a vacation before where you were even away from all the "bad" people (lol) and issues, yet you still had a hard time enjoying yourself, even on vacation.

drama-seeking can get so bad that some of us only find relief from drama by ingesting substances that alter our mood; drugs and alcohol seem like the only way to receive some temporary relifef. of course, these things just add more problems into our lives while giving no real relief in the process.

the devil uses this tool of "drama-seeking" in our lives to keep us where we are while not allowing us to grow in God and reap the rewards of living for Jesus.

so what do we need to do in a nutshell to eliminate drama-seeking behavior and attitudes?...........avoid disputes, avoid problems, drop them and run, look for good, believe for the best, start refraining from voicing the negativity in your life, start proclaiming the victories God's giving to you in your life!

sometimes this kind of negative, drama-filled thinking that we're used to causes us to expect drama. drama becomes something weve gotten used to. it's like a large riverbed that has been dug deep into our thought process.

here are some practical ways to re-direct this current of negative, drama-seeking behavior that we've gotten used to living with:

first, you have to MAKE A DECISION....to change, change your thought life.

second, you have to start re-training your mind to think the way God wants you to. so how does God want you to think....He tells us in Scripture.

Philip 4:8 - Finally, brothers, whatever is true, whatever is honorable, whatever is just, whatever is pure, whatever is lovely, whatever is commendable, if there is any excellence, if there is anything worthy of praise, think about these things.

third, its gonna take a little time to retrain your thinking, and it can happen as fast as you want it to. DAILY you must start capturing negative, doubtful, dark, and pessimistic thoughts and start replacing them with positive, Scripture-filled, God breathed thoughts.

fourth, and most importantly, before you attempt to do any of the first three steps, GIVE this drama-filled, negative lifestyle over to God and asking Him to help you change.

Jesus saved you, and truthfully He never stops saving you. He can save you from this as well.

You can do all things through Christ who strengthens you. Start avoiding drama and start thinking Scripture-filled thoughts of victory. A Victorious-type of thinking will lead to a natural gravitation away from drama, leaving those who'd like to start trouble with you in the dust....you wont have time for their mess.

you can do this. God has made you able through His strength.
